Traverse/Leelanau/Petoskey does have a good permaculture, bioneers, art community network, economy is supported through wealthy tourists. Alternatively, Kalamazoo is stronger than Muskegon or other SW MI areas for their permie support. Ann Arbor is the hub on the east side.
I went to college at Northland up in Ashland, WI, and I have yet to experience the type of community, both on and off campus as I was able to there. Green local building, sustainable farms on a variety of scales, local food support, strong indigenous community. And this was ages ago.
